I had pretty high expectations after reading all of the other reviews. I can happily say that I am impressed with the final product and when paired with the front 1.5" leveling springs, the truck overall rides better than it did stock. The roads in Colorado have to be some of the worst in the country and I can actually drink my coffee again going down the road. This is still however a 3/4-ton truck and the separation joints in the highway are still quite apparent but not as dramatic as they were before the spring install (less bucking). It's not a complete night and day difference but it is an improvement for sure and well worth the money. As far as the install goes, I disconnected my shocks, sway bar and axle anti-hop shock and still had a hell of a time getting the springs in. No matter how hard I pushed down on the axle I couldn't get it low enough to get the spring into place. Ended up using my threaded spring compressors which allowed me to slip them right into place. I do have more sway in the rear end now going over bumps, so I think my next purchase will be the rear track bar to try and settle that down.
